Learning Objectives
5 objectives- Understand the fundamental concepts and importance of inclusive education.
- Identify relevant legislation and policies that support inclusive education practices.
- Develop strategies to create and maintain inclusive classroom environments.
- Apply differentiated instruction and Universal Design for Learning principles to meet diverse learner needs.
- Collaborate effectively with educators, families, and communities to support inclusive education.
